MaliBuckeye and I are at it again this afternoon, as we are joined by award winning film maker Bob DeMars to talk about his upcoming documentary "The Business of Amateurs." Mali and I talk to Bob about the state of college football and the definition of the student athlete, plus the great work he is putting into this documentary and how he would fix the current issues in the college football landscape and the issues that scholarship athletes face. Bob is an award-winning filmmaker with over a decade of experience producing, writing, and directing. In 2009 he produced his first documentary “Adjust Your Color: The Truth of Petey Greene”, which was narrated by Don Cheadle. The film was distributed by PBS’s “Independent Lens” and went on to win the program’s Audience Award for the year. He received his degree from USC's Marshall School of Business. He played defensive end for USC from three different head coaches at USC from 1997-2001.
